[0020] Such as figure 1 and figure 2 As shown, the upper end of the pillar 1 of the T-shaped hydrofoil is fixed on the bottom of the ship; the lower end is connected to the horizontal main wing 2; the pillar 1 is vertically connected to the horizontal main wing 2; the flap 3 is hinged to the horizontal main wing 2, and the hydraulic cylinder drives the swing of the flap 3 , 6 is the cylinder rod of the hydraulic cylinder; the aileron plate 4 is located at the two ends of the horizontal main wing 2 and there is a small gap between the horizontal main wing 2, which is convenient for the aileron plate to swing, and the aileron plate 4 and the horizontal main wing 2 are driven by hydraulic pressure. Transmission shaft connection, see below for the specific connection form.
